The Best US RSC: NY, BH, or Dallas?
I've heard good things about all three, but I have probably heard the best about Dallas. I will say, however, that the times I have called the Manhattan RSC, they were a bit snooty, whereas the Dallas reps seemed more pleasant and willing to help. Never had any experience with the Beverly Hills location.
Also, is it best to establish a history with one RSC and stick with them for subsequent services, or does this type of "relationship" not matter much? |

I had only one service, and had it done last summer at the BH RSC. I thought they did a good job (in about 4 weeks' time). The watch looked brand-new. I called Dallas just for fun, and they said they would give me a Tudor "loaner" to wear while my Rolex was in the shop. In the end I decided to go with BH because I could personally drop it off and pick it up (too reluctant to mail it anywhere). I really missed the watch while it was gone, though, and a loaner would have been nice.
